Humidity Control

Many wine cellars come with an active humidity control system. This means that a sensor detects the amount of moisture present in the air and then uses a fan to blow cool humid air into the refrigerator and raise the humidity to an ideal level. This will ensure that the corks stay soft and flexible, and that the bottles are properly sealed to safeguard the wine from oxidation. This also helps keep the labels legible, and prevents the growth of mold.

This is crucial for wines that require storage for a long time since oxidation alters the flavor and color of the wine. The control of humidity stops these changes from occurring and ensures that the wines remain in good condition for a longer time.

A standard fridge isn't the ideal place to store wine because it doesn't provide enough humidity control and may be too cold. Excessively cold temperatures could cause the liquid inside the bottle to freeze, which can break or pop the cork and ruin the contents. A wine rack refrigerator will not expose the bottles to such extreme temperatures, thus ensuring that they maintain their integrity and don't freeze.

The exposure to odors is an additional issue that can be found in a regular refrigerator. The aromas of leftover food and other food items can be transferred into the wine, causing a loss of the flavor and taste. A wine fridge can avoid this problem by removing any other items from the storage area and keeping it dedicated to wine.

Dual Zone Cooling

Many wine drinkers enjoy an array of different wines, and a dual zone fridge is an excellent choice for them. These fridges include a cooling system that allows you to set two different temperature profiles. For instance, you could store your white wines at an icy crisp, crisp 46-56 degrees Fahrenheit and keep reds at a warmer more cellar-like temperature of 55-65 degrees Fahrenheit. This lets you keep a selection of your most loved wines at the ideal serving temperature while enjoying the entire selection at once.

Another benefit of these units is their ability to accommodate large, magnum-sized bottles. They usually include extra space for larger wine bottles, allowing you to store and serve more of your favorite labels. A lot of models come with shelves that are removable, making it easy to adjust the racks to accommodate different sizes of bottles.
